Tuesday, 1 August 2017

PHP CSS menampilkan tanggal seperti kalender

<?php
$hari=date('w');
$tgl =date('d');
$bln =date('m');
$thn =date('Y');

switch($hari)
{    
        case 0 : {$hari='Minggu';}break;
        case 1 : {$hari='Senin';}break;
        case 2 : {$hari='Selasa';}break;
        case 3 : {$hari='Rabu';}break;
        case 4 : {$hari='Kamis';}break;
        case 5 : {$hari="Jum'at";}break;
        case 6 : {$hari='Sabtu';}break;
        default: {$hari='UnKnown';}break;
}
   
switch($bln)
{      
        case 1 : {$bln='Jan';}break;
        case 2 : {$bln='Feb';}break;
        case 3 : {$bln='Mar';}break;
        case 4 : {$bln='Apr';}break;
        case 5 : {$bln='Mei';}break;
        case 6 : {$bln="Jun";}break;
        case 7 : {$bln='Jul';}break;
        case 8 : {$bln='Agu';}break;
        case 9 : {$bln='Sep';}break;
        case 10 : {$bln='Okt';}break;    
        case 11 : {$bln='Nov';}break;
        case 12 : {$bln='Des';}break;
        default: {$bln='UnK';}break;
}
$sekarang=" ".$hari." , ".$tgl." ".$bln." ".$thn;
?>

<style type="text/css">
h2.date-header {
  margin: 45px 10px 0 0;
  float:center;
  background:rgba(87, 87, 87, 0.2);
  border-radius:5px;
  font-weight: bold;
  width: 75px;
  height: 85px;
  text-align: center;
  box-shadow: 0px 1px 0px rgba(255, 255, 255, 0.3), inset 0px 1px 3px rgba(0, 0, 0, 0.2);
}
.date-header .bln {
  font-size: 16px;
  width: 75px;
  margin: 0 auto;
  padding: 3px 0;
  color: #666;
  background:rgba(87, 87, 87, 0.1);
  border-radius:5px 5px 0 0;
  text-shadow: 1px 1px 0px #BABABA;
  box-shadow:0px 2px 1px #9C9C9C, inset 0 2px 50px rgba(0, 0, 0, 0.2);
}
.date-header .hr {
  color:#fff;
  font-size: 40px;
  width: 75px;
  margin: 0 auto;
  text-shadow: 0px 1px 0px #000;padding-top:5px;
}
</style>

<h2 class='date-header'>
<div class='bln'><?php echo "$bln $thn";?></div> <div class='hr'><?php echo "$tgl";?></div>
</h2>

No comments:

Post a Comment